Sustainable Holistic Action For Livelihood Alternatives And Raise (SHALAR) Foundation is a new born organization focused on working with tribal communities. While the organization is new, its mission is to address the needs and challenges faced by tribal population. This includes areas like education, healthcare, economic empowerment and cultural preservation. The foundation aims to collaborate with tribal communities to create sustainable solutions and improve their overall well-being.

The Foundation primarily focuses on rural communities and small and marginal farmers, with special attention to sustainable agriculture, natural farming, women’s empowerment, environmental conservation and community-based development.

Our History

Brief Description of the Organization

  • Mr. Pramod Kumar Panda holds masters in Sociology degree, worked for 14 years in 3 different NGO’s before initiating this “Sustainable Holistic Action for Livelihood Alternatives and Rise foundation” (SHALAR) in Rayagada district of Odisha state.
  • He has witnessed firsthand struggle of rural poor Tribal’s living in Dry land, Rainfed areas as very small and marginal farm holders, experiencing impact of serious negative climate changes on agribased livelihoods and forcing them to migrate to nearby states as forced distress migrate workers. So, he founded “SHALAR” foundation to work for Sustainable Holistic Action for Livelihood Alternatives and Rise.
  • He has grassroots experience in conducting Training Sessions, workshops and demonstrations to educate tribal farmers about zero budget natural farming (ZBNF) Principles and Techniques.
  • Experienced in facilitating conservation of indigenous seed varieties and promoting seed exchange among tribal farmers to preserve biodiversity and ensure access to locally adopted seeds.
  • Experienced in providing guidance on soil health improvement techniques and naturals pest and disease management methods. Experienced in managing and advocating for indigenous cow, goat, chicken and fish breeds.
